I downloaded Hezyap latest version 10.0.9 and followed the documentation to integrate the following 3rd party ad networks

  • AdColony
  • AppLovin
  • Chartboost
  • Vungle
  • UntiyAds
  • Admob

I've created app for each ad networks in their respective admin portal and configured all necessary details in Heyzap admin portal. I then downloaded Heyzap sdk and placed in Unity project, took build and published a development build for Android

When I launch app, I got a test suite screen with all ad networks in off state. Please see the attached screenshot. But, for all configured ad networks, SDK Available is ON ( green color) , but "Configuration Not Present" and "SDK Failed to Start" in red color

If you email support@heyzap.com with your Heyzap account name and app bundle identifier, we can look into this for you. We're sorting out a bug on our side today that may be causing this, but we need a bit more information to solve it, so that'd be helpful.

(In general, this error would mean that credentials are missing for this network on the dashboard, but I think in your case, today, it is an error on our end).
